Anker SOLIX 2x F3800 Solar Generator Portable Power Stations + Double Power Hub (12000W | 7.68kWh)

These Two SOLIX F3800 Portable Power Stations from Anker come with a Double Power Hub so you can store the energy you need to use your most important devices and appliances during power outages. Each power station provides up to 3840 watt-hours of power, and the Double Power Hub connects them to operate as a single unit. Each power station's inverter has multiple AC outlets, USB ports, and even ports for large appliances and electric vehicles. The power stations themselves can be recharged from AC, solar, or vehicle DC sources.

Power Your Home During Outages
Each SOLIX F3800 stores and delivers up to 3840 watt-hours of power for important appliances, devices, tools, and home systems. Maximum output is 6000 watts with up to 9000 surge watts available for the startup draw from things like power tools.
Multiple Outlets and Ports

The F3800's inverter is equipped with five AC outlets: one AC outlet rated for car charging, two 12W USB-A ports, and three 100W USB-C ports. It supplies both 120V power for most electrical appliances and devices and 240V power for large appliances such as dryers.

Recharging the Power Station
The batteries can be charged via an AC outlet, from a vehicle charger DC outlet, from a solar panel array with input of up to 2400 watts, or even from an electric car.

Expandable Ecosystem
F3800 power stations can be connected with up to six expansion batteries for a total capacity of 26,880 watt-hours. They can also be integrated into your home's electrical system with separately sold accessories and professional installation.

Handle & Wheels for Easy Handling
At 132 pounds, the SOLIX F3800 isn't lightweight, but the base of the unit features front casters, rear wheels, plus handles at the top and bottom for easy transport.

Anker SOLIX F3800 Product FAQs

Q1: What should I do when using a solar charger to charge Anker SOLIX F3800?

A: The solar input supports an 11-60V solar charger with an XT-60 connector. If you use an 11-32V solar charger, the current supports 10A max. When you use a 32-60V solar charger, the current supports 25A max.

Q2: Why is the power station not working after it hasn't been used for a long time?

A: If the power station is stored at a low capacity for a long time, lithium batteries will self-consume power which may lead to a quick discharge. This leads to poor conductivity and a reduced battery lifespan, resulting in poor battery performance.

Q3: How should I store and maintain the power station?

A: To store your portable power station, make sure you have:
1. Turned off all outputs.
2. Store it in a cool and dry place.
3. Check the battery capacity each week. If it's below 30%, fully charge.
4. Charge the power station to 100% every 3 months.

Q4: In UPS mode, does the 240V ports work?

A: In UPS mode, only the three 120V ports labeled "UPS" are operational; the 240V ports do not function.

Q5: How do I charge my electric vehicle?

A: Double-press the 240V power switch to activate EV mode charging, then you can recharge your EV.
